MOT manual:
quote:
Vehicles first used before 1 April 1986:
A hazard warning device is not required by Regulation, but, if one is fitted, it must be tested. The hazard warning lamp 'tell tale' may
be a separate light or the same as the indicator 'tell-tale. However, it must be a flashing light.
